Output 63d496dfc81cd82ae3c3a9c4ab0b7d3c08f4723524ae817de7b21d76b49526fe:0

value
66622
script pubkey
OP_0 OP_PUSHBYTES_20 e565e3355a6e1db1665abccad72565c3d2391e6b
address
bc1qu4j7xd26dcwmzej6hn9dwft9c0frj8ntpp6jgf
transaction
63d496dfc81cd82ae3c3a9c4ab0b7d3c08f4723524ae817de7b21d76b49526fe
spent
true